Re: Monitor not remembering settings



You should be able to run "xvidtune" in order to get the right modeline.
Set your screen as you like then click on "show."  This will kick out a
modeline.
Find the modline in your /etc/X11/XF86Config file, in the appropriate
section, that starts with the same desktop size as xvidtune reports.
For example something along the lines of "1024x768." Comment that line out and paste the new modeline xvidtune created into the file.
Save the file and restart X.

Well it's remembering the resolution setting. The problem is that it's not remembering the geometry settings like the pincusion, trapezoid, etc. so the screen is all bent out of shape (in the proper resolution).
